From Japanese horror filmmaker Koji Shiraishi, often considered a master of the found footage format, comes the underrated and under seen film "A Record of Sweet Murder," which was made in South Korea and stars a partially South Korean cast. Here's my review highlighting the movie as an under the radar gem.
